About The Job

Alignerr connects top technical experts with leading AI labs to build, evaluate, and improve next-generation models. We work on real production systems and high-impact research workflows across data, tooling, and infrastructure.

Position

Senior C++ Full-Stack Engineer — AI Data & Infrastructure

Type: Contract, Remote Commitment: 20–40 hours/week Compensation: Competitive, hourly (based on experience)

Role Responsibilities

* Design, build, and optimize high-performance systems in C++ supporting AI data pipelines and evaluation workflows

* Develop full-stack tooling and backend services for large-scale data annotation, validation, and quality control

* Improve reliability, performance, and safety across existing C++ codebases

* Collaborate with data, research, and engineering teams to support model training and evaluation workflows

* Identify bottlenecks and edge cases in data and system behavior, and implement scalable fixes

* Participate in synchronous reviews to iterate on system design and implementation decisions

Qualifications

Must-Have

* Native or fluent English speaker

* Full-stack developer experience with a strong systems programming background

* 5+ years of professional experience writing production C++.

* Experience working with the C++ frontends of ML frameworks or inference runtimes.

* Familiarity with hardware acceleration APIs for optimizing model inference.

* Clear written and verbal communication skills.

* Ability to commit 20–40 hours per week.

Preferred

* Prior experience with data annotation, data quality, or evaluation systems

* Familiarity with AI/ML workflows, model training, or benchmarking pipelines

* Experience with distributed systems or developer tooling
